Ingredients
  • 12 Oreo cookies or Oreo Fudge Covered Cookies
  • 1 1/2 cup milk chocolate chips only if using regular Oreos
  • 12 Hershey Milk Chocolate Kisses
  • 1 box Wilton Icing Writer Decorating Tubes only if using Oreo Fudge Covered Cookies
  • Halloween sprinkles I used black and orange nonpareils
Instructions
Using regular Oreo:
  1. Cover a baking sheet with waxed paper and set it aside.

  2. Add the chocolate chips to a microwave-safe bowl and microwave for 1 minute, stir well and microwave in 30-second intervals until the chocolate is melted. Make sure to stir well after each interval.

  3. Using two forks, dip the Oreos in the melted chocolate and place them on the prepared baking sheet.

  4. Immediately top each cookie with a Hershey's kiss and decorate with sprinkles.

  5. Let the chocolate set before serving.

Using fudge-covered Oreos:
  1. Arrange the cookies on a cutting board or plate.

  2. Using the icing, attach an unwrapped Hershey Kiss on top of each cookie.

  3. After that, ice a line around each Hershey Kiss and cover it with Halloween sprinkles.
